GaN chargers have shifted from niche to mainstream and are reshaping how people power phones, laptops, earbuds, and travel gear. Gallium nitride (GaN) is a semiconductor material that replaces silicon in power electronics, enabling higher efficiency and much smaller charger designs without sacrificing output.
